SECTION 7

THREE PHASE FLEXPAK PLUS MODIFICATION KIT

INSTRUCTION MANUALS

7.0 General

- A number of optional features in the

form of Modification Kits are offered with the three

phase, FlexPak Plus controller. Each of these Kits exĆ

tends the control of the unit and tailors its operation to

specific application needs.
This Section describes the procedures that must be folĆ

lowed to install the Kits. Refer to Table 7.A for an informaĆ

tional listing.

Many of the Modification Kits are designed to make

electrical connection with the Regulator Module by

means of pinĆtype connectors. These slide up through

matching holes in the Modules that form part of the Kit.

(Refer to Figure 7.1.)

PINS MUST BE PARALLEL

Figure 7.1 - Pin Alignment

A common installation problem is caused by bent,

broken or incorrectly placed pins. Since improper opĆ

eration results, care must be taken. Exact alignment is

critical. Visually check that only one pin extends to the

top of each slot once the connection is made.
Many of the Modification Kits require the removal of one

or more jumpers from the Regulator Module. In such

cases, carefully clip the leads on both sides of each

jumper and discard it. Use a sharp pair of dykes (diagoĆ

nal cutters) to assure a quick, clean cut. Do not twist the

tool, since damage may result.
In cases where the Kit is secured by a mounting screw,

be sure to tighten it firmly but do not overtighten. ExĆ

cessive force can strip the threads.
